Refer to the Important Safety Instructions before operation.

-Hold the front handle ((314) with one hand, depressing the front grip safety (C/5).

-Graspthe rear handle(C/6)with the other handandstartthe trimmer with the rear grip safety (Ch').

Caution: The trimmer will start immediately!

Note: The hedge trimmer will start only when both grip safeties (C/5 and C n ) are depressed.

Toswitchoff: Releaseoneor bothgrip safeties.Thetrimmer will stop immediately.

Do not attempt to cut branches thicker than 16 mm (0.6) diameterwith this trimmer. These shouldfirst be cut with shears (fig. D)down to the hedgetrimmer level.

Hold the trimmer with both hands and move it in front of your body (see fig. E).

When operatingthe trimmer, keep extension cord behindtrim- mer. Never drape it over hedge being trimmer.

CAUTION:

Be careful not to accidentallycontact a metalfence or other hard objects while trimming. The blade will break and may cause serious injury.

Do not attempt to trim too much at a time, or malfunctionof the tool may result.

Overreaching with a hedge trimmer, particularly from a ladder, is extremely dangerous. Don't work from anything wobbly or infirm (see fig. F).
